Tight schedule. It could get tight if you consider a drying time of 6 to 8 weeks for the screed. Our site handover was on 27.03.2017, house completed on 29.07.2017.
It’s possible when you have a reliable company working on it. Including the screed and its drying time.
The schedule is really tight but, according to the construction timeline, very well coordinated with hardly any breaks. So far, the company has reliably met the deadlines as per their references. The windows are scheduled to arrive at the end of April, and the screed will be installed in mid-May.
We have been positively surprised so far. We need to move out of our house by the end of August. Otherwise, we would have a problem...

Whether a reliable home construction company would build that quickly is an interesting question. It still seems (too) fast to me, but maybe possible with a prefabricated house. I would be skeptical with traditional brick-and-mortar construction. How much residual moisture did your screed have when the floor covering was installed?
Don’t get me wrong, I wish you all the best; this is not meant to be critical. I’m just doubtful about the short drying time.

We will have fast-drying screed. Furthermore, until the house is completed, only the tiles will be installed. Our vinyl flooring will not be delivered until early August. Eight weeks of drying time with the help of construction dryers should be sufficient. It was no different with our current house.
